This series explores the lives of significant artists and their contemporaries, studied in the context of their school or period. Each book explains how the artists were affected by contempory world events such as the World Wars and in turn how society was affected by the artists work - Also looks at 'the next generation', providing biographies of artists influenced by the movement under discussion - resources section providing suggestions of further reading and websites and places to visit, a timeline and maps, glossary and index
